Chiefs rookie defensive tackle Omarr Norman-Lott is out for Friday’s season-opener, and Chargers guard Mekhi Becton will play.
Those are the two names of interest among the inactives submitted 90 minutes prior to Friday’s kickoff against the Chargers in São Paulo, Brazil (7 p.m. CT, YouTube, KSHB-TV 41, 96.5 The Fan).
Norman-Lott injured his ankle early in training camp, then aggravated the injury in the second preseason game at Seattle Aug. 15. He’s been limited in practice ever since. The Chiefs’ second-round selection (63rd overall) in the 2025 draft, Norman-Lott will have to wait until at least next week to make his NFL debut.e
Becton, who signed a two-year, $20 million free-agent contract with the Chargers this past March, was added to the injury report earlier in the day Friday as questionable with an illness. He was seen warming up prior to the team officially making him active. It’s uncertain whether he’ll start.
